PEOPLE AND PLACES
BPM Senior Living, headquartered in Port- land, Oregon, resumed the management of two communities: Regency Park in Portland and Royalton Place in Milwaukie, Oregon. BPM also operates five other communities across California, Nevada, and Oregon.

Housing, Texas-based LifeWell Senior Living and CarePredict announced that they are developing and deploying CarePredict’s Tempo™, a wearable device that measures activity and behavioral patterns of seniors using machine-learning algorithms and smart locations technology.
Watercrest Senior Living, based in Vero Beach, Florida, announced that its Port St. Lucie, Florida community, Watercrest of St. Lucie West Assisted Living and Memory Care Community, is scheduled to open in late 2017. The community will offer 102 assist- ed living and 26 memory care residences. Additionally, Watercrest celebrated the groundbreaking of Market Street Memory Care Residences in Tampa, Florida. The 64-residence memory care community will open to residents in January 2018.

The Arbor Company, headquartered in Atlan- ta, Georgia, named Tami Cumings the company’s new senior vice president of sales and marketing. In her new position,
Cumings will lead Arbor’s sales and market- ing nationwide, supporting more than 30 independent living, assisted living, and de- mentia care communities.
Atria Senior Living announced that Michael Brown has been named the executive director of Atria at Villages of Windsor in Lake Worth, Florida. Michael Kolesar has been named the community’s sales director. Brown has near- ly 20 years of senior living experience and joined Atria in 1998. Koselar has more than 20 years of hospitality sales and operations experience and has served in sales and train- ing roles with Atria since 2011.

William (Bill) McGinley, executive director of New Pond Village, a Brightview Senior Living community, received the 2017 American College of Health Care Admin-
istrators Distinguished Assisted Living Ad-
ministrator award. The award recognizes an ACHCA Fellow who has demonstrated the highest professional standards as an admin- istrator in post-acute and aging services.
